The long format of this Demirci Kula is striking. In this respect, it resembles an example published by Eskenazi in 1983. Typical of the provenance, the design of five blue medallions filled with carnations and hyacinths and surrounded by floral stems here adorns a red-brown field ground. Nine small ewers (ibrik) have been incorporated. The golden yellow main border, with an angular vine attached to tulips, carnations and roses, is particularly beautiful. The vine divides the ground of the border into triangular compartments. The floral design of the rug is deeply influenced by Ottoman court art.
